UAAP 86 HSBVB: Adamson’s Nitura-Sagaysay crush UPIS to open campaign


ADAMSON University’s Shai Nitura and Fel Sagaysay overpowered UP Integrated School’s Khloe Long and Janella Guarino, 21-6, 21-7, for a winning start Friday night in the UAAP Season 86 High School Girls’ Beach Volleyball tournament at the Sands SM By The Bay.

The Baby Falcons placed second last year.

In their swan song for Adamson, Nitura and Sagaysay hope to emerge triumphant in the sand court just like on the taraflex floor last February.

Far Eastern University-Diliman’s Frenchie Premaylon and Love Lopez subdued National University Nazareth School’s Vilmarie Toos and Laiza Benigay, 21-13, 21-17, to earn win No. 1.

De La Salle-Zobel’s Aislinn Alemaña and Katrina Tria bested Ateneo’s Reggie Sanchez and Abigail May Martija, 21-11, 21-14, to complete opening day winners.

University of Santo Tomas, last season’s champions, drew a bye. In the boys’ division, holders Baby Tamaraws overcame a tough opening day match to secure their first win.

FEU-D’s Kyle Tandoc and Amet Bituin went into the wringer in the second set to beat UST’s John Lagaran and Lance Malinao, 21-15, 24-22.

NUNS’ John Wayne Dionela and Rain Skyler Gemarino turned back Adamson’s CJ Dominquto and Brandy Clemente, 21-18, 21-19.

University of the East also made an early statement as Jan Macam and Xyrone Montemayor rout De La Salle-Zobel’s Mario Roxas and Christopher Pallega, 21-8, 21-13

In the opening day’s only three-setter, Ateneo’s Mon Paquito Berdos and Santiago Andres Avila outlasted UPIS’ Juan Miguel Navarro and Japeth Ben Casabar, 15-21, 21-16, 15-12.
